This was the first U.S. city to have a professional baseball team, the Cincinnati Reds. Esquire magazine called it one of the "Cities that Rock," and Forbes magazine rates it among America's most wired cities. Call Cincinnati what you want: We call it home. And Xavier's campus is just north of downtown, making it convenient and easy to poke around all of the neighborhoods, night spots and more.
